The kisan mahapanchayat comprising a large number of farmers here on Monday took three decisions.

Gurnam Singh Charuni addressed the farmers.

Advertisement

It was decided that FIRs should be registered against those involved in the recent lathicharge on farmers.

They served an ultimatum till September 6.

Charuni appealed to the farmers to reach the mahapanchayat in UP on September 5.

He also threatened to gherao the Mini Secretariat in Karnal from September 7 if the demands were not met.

They demanded a compensation of Rs 25 lakh to the family and a job to the son of the deceased farmer.

Charuni said they would urge the SKM to take stringent action as they would not let the farmers of Haryana to be beaten mercilessly by police.

All farm unions of Haryana will raise the issue before the SKM.

Charuni demanded a financial assistance of Rs 2 lakh each to the injured farmers.

He said the farmers would assemble in the Karnal grain market on September 7.
